Missio
Also known as: Mission, The Pontifical Mission Societies
The main object of the charity is to support the Catholic Church in mission dioceses throughout the world. This support is most tangible in the funds raised and distributed but is most keenly felt in the spiritual and pastoral unity which is generated.Therefore we have two main areas of activity, mission animation and education, and fund raising - without the one we could not have the other!

Annual Returns
As filed with the Charity Commission for England and Wales. Most recent filing covers the financial year ending 2024.
| Financial Year | Income | Expenditure | Charitable Spending | Net Assets | Reserves | Staff |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| £5,630,749 | £4,443,056 | £4,089,563 | £6,208,643 | £600,000 | 18 / 7000 |
| 2023 | £4,055,297 | £4,915,470 | £4,562,017 | £5,020,950 | £250,000 | 18 / 7000 |
| 2022 | £5,104,011 | £4,944,845 | £4,635,385 | £5,881,123 | £250,000 | 15 / 7000 |
| 2021 | £5,074,822 | £3,200,941 | £2,926,188 | £5,721,957 | £250,000 | 16 / 7000 |
| 2020 | £4,010,823 | £5,081,379 | £4,768,984 | £3,848,076 | £250,000 | 21 / 6000 |
Staff column shows: Employees / Volunteers

When was Missio registered as a charity?
Missio was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 9 July 1996 as charity number 1056651. It has been registered for 30 years.
